Texas 2025 - 89th 1st C.S.

Texas House Bill HR6

Caption

Commemorating the 20 Year Founder's Day Celebration of the Cy-Fair Republican Women of Harris County.

Summary

House Resolution 6 commemorates the 20 Year Founder's Day Celebration of the Cy-Fair Republican Women (CFRW) in Harris County, a group founded in 2005 with the mission to promote Republican principles. This celebration honors the club’s achievements over two decades in engaging politically and supporting candidates at various levels. The resolution recognizes the leadership of current president Trish Powell and highlights the contributions of the club’s original members during the celebration on July 8, 2025.
